I have another REALLY good PB sauce. It's simple:

2 parts sugar
1 part water
1 part Peanut Butter (although I add a little more but not too much so it's thicker)

In pan bring sugar and water to a boil and let boil for 45 seconds to a minute so the sugar completely dissolves. Add peanut butter and wisk until smooth. Let cool before pouring on your ice cream though. Oh yeah, use creamy peanut butter.

You can store any leftovers in the refrigerator but it will kind of crystalize a bit. I heat it for 30 seconds or so and mix it. Heat another 30 seconds and the crystals go away once it gets hot enough and you can mix it until smooth.
